Dr. David Sinclair certainly has a vested interest in this. He is a paid advisor to Shaklee, the maker of Vivix. The WSJ reports that at a conference last summer, Sinclair told Shaklee salespeople that “over a year ago, we set out together to do this, to make a product that you could actually activate these genetic pathways that can slow down aging.”
After the WSJ asked him about his connection to Shaklee, Sinclair resigned from his advisory role at the company.
